Екатерина
Дата регистрации: 2014-09-15 09:43:41
Ник: Екатерина
Комментариев: 20
- Как запретить проверку комментария на XSS?
- Можно ли изменить ЧПУ в MaxSite CMS?
- Улучшение "Популярных статей"
- Как настроить блока «Поделиться» от Яндекса?
- Подсветка кода в редакторе контента
- Сортировка записей в рубриках (и не только)
- Как добавить дополнительные поля для рубрик?
- Скрытие неиспользуемых опций
- Две формы на одной странице
- Как добавить вкладку в разделе редактирования статьи?
- Вариант формы комментариев
- Как уменьшить время загрузки страницы? Не количество запросов к БД
Комментарии
- Плагин category_editor - редактор категорий/рубрик
2017-04-30 00:08:37
Сергей, есть ли новые версии плагина?
- Плагин category_editor - редактор категорий/рубрик
2016-07-10 00:13:22
Спасибо, Сергей! Нужный плагин!
Будет ли в новой версии возможность закрепления записей в рубрике?
- Плагин category_editor - редактор категорий/рубрик
2016-05-31 12:43:23
Спасибо, Сергей! Работает!
- Плагин category_editor - редактор категорий/рубрик
2016-05-31 10:30:17
Появился вопрос. Как получить доступ к значению метаполя категории, если мы на странице PAGE, а не CATEGORY. То есть как в этот код добавить условие, из какой именно категории считывается метаполе?
CategoryEditor::getInstance()->ВАШ КЛЮЧ
- Как уменьшить время загрузки страницы? Не количество запросов к БД
2016-05-26 23:02:40
А если в целом, 2с. считается большим временем загрузки? Какое время считается оптимальным (диапазон)?
- Как уменьшить время загрузки страницы? Не количество запросов к БД
2016-05-26 17:51:49
Илья, Спасибо за рекомендации!
при любом кешировании первоначальная загрузка страницы будет долгой
Да, я ориентировалась не на первую загрузку страницы при включении кэширования, а на последующие. При последующих загрузках в информации указывается, что используется 0 запросов к БД, то есть вообще нет запросов. При этом время загрузки страницы не опускается ниже 1,5с. Я правильно понимаю, что mso_get_cache и mso_add_cache мне не помогут в этом случае?
А циклы foreach могут влиять на время исполнения скрипта? Например, если на странице 10 циклов и каждый по 1000 обходов, это много?
P.S. при отправке этого вопроса на МаксХабе в информации было указано больше 80 запросов SQL и ооочень маленькое время загрузки.
- Плагин pagination_more - ajax-пагинация «показать больше»
2016-05-26 15:15:16
Разобралась с этим вопросом!
- Плагин pagination_more - ajax-пагинация «показать больше»
2016-05-25 10:27:18
Тут вопрос скорее не в подгружаемых записях, а в количестве выводимых записей на страницах пагинации (nex/2 next/3). Как сделать, чтобы на главной странице (или next/1) выводилось 5 записей, а на остальных (nex/2 next/3) по 10?
В какую сторону копать?
- Плагин pagination_more - ajax-пагинация «показать больше»
2016-05-25 08:41:32
Можно ли изменить количество выводимых записей при пагинации? Например, на первой (главной) странице выводить 5 записей, а на всех последующих по 10 записей.
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 16:24:41
Больше вопросов нет =) Пока...
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 16:18:55
Если что, то сначала можете без документации выкладывать, будем разбираться методом тыка =)
Кстати, еще вроде нету опции удаления дополнительных полей (метаполей).
А в разделе "Настройки полей" поле "Значение", оно только для типа select работает?
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 16:10:40
А когда будет обновление? =)
Еще нашла интересную фишку =) Если взять за иконку расширителя поля и потянуть в область другого поля, то в перетягиваемое поле вставится ссылка на редактор категорий =)
По всем вопросам понятно, надо поразбираться с типом SELECT...
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 13:02:04
Еще вопрос. У метаполей для категорий 3 значения: маленькое поле, большое и список. Но при изменении типа ничего не происходит, так и должно быть?
Можно сделать, например, для большого текстового поля тип TEXTAREA и возможность подключения текстового редактора. По такому же принципу, как сейчас реализовано у редактора страниц. Там сейчас так: используется дефолтный текстовый редактор, а если подключен плагин текстового редактора, то используется он.
Тогда будет удобно для категории размещать статью, к каждой категории будет возможность прикрепить статью через метаполе.
Еще к TEXTAREA можно подключить это: http://codemirror.net/mode/htmlmixed/index.html
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 12:40:56
Этот плагин, кстати, уже надо переименовывать, так как это не просто работа с категориями, а намного мощнее штука получается =)
Сейчас не хватает возможности закрепления записей в рубрике. Например, сейчас в категории записи с индексами: 51 52 53 54 55 56 57. Например, первые три нам надо закрепить навсегда (или временно), мы их отмечаем галочками, и выбираем действие с отмеченными (снизу из списка) - ЗАКРЕПИТЬ, после этого данные записи закрепляются на позиции 51 52 53 и становятся, например, серыми. И так будет до тех пор, пока мы не сделаем ОТКРЕПИТЬ.
Таким образом, даже новая запись, с индексом 0, встанет в списке только 4, после этих.
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 12:29:51
Скоро опубликую последнюю версию
Вот это хорошая новость. У меня вот тоже идеи есть, может подкинуть вам? =)
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 12:28:11
Изменить порядок не получится просто. Да и зачем?
Чтобы закрепить запись/записи выше остальных, присвоив бОльший индекс. А в случае прямого порядка сортировки, новые записи всегда будут становиться выше.
Или есть другой способ закрепить требуемые записи?
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 02:09:47
То есть это наоборот прямой порядок получается. А как изменить, чтобы был обратный порядок сортировки (от большего к меньшему)?
Что будет, если новая запись будет добавлена в раздел, то как она отсортируется, относительно других записей, которые ранее уже подверглись сотритовке и им присвоен ПОРЯДОК?
- Плагин category_editor - редактор категорий/рубрик
2016-05-23 01:56:27
Сергей, а порядок сортировки обратный? Страницы с меньшим индексом стоят выше в списке?
- Как уменьшить количество запросов в базу данных?
2016-05-23 01:22:51
if ($home_cache_time > 0 and $k = mso_get_cache($home_cache_key) ) echo $k; // да есть в кэше
- Как уменьшить количество запросов в базу данных?
2016-05-23 01:21:26
Спасибо, Сергей!
Вопрос: кэширование, которое включено в database.php $db['default']['cache_on'] = TRUE;, чем откличается от кэширования, которое в шаблоне включается, выборочно? :
#добавляем в кэш mso_add_cache($home_cache_key, ob_get_flush(), $home_cache_time * 60); # используем кэширование $home_cache_time = (int) mso_get_option('home_cache_time', 'templates', 0); $home_cache_key = getinfo('template') . '-' . __FILE__ . '-' . mso_current_paged() . '-' . $UNIT_NUM;
Плагин friendly_urls - настраиваемые ЧПУ
Шаблон Prestizh
Мультиязычный сайт на MaxSite